Summary
Discusses the Underground Railroad, the secret, loosely organized network of people and places that helped many slaves escape north to freedom.

Contents
How the Underground Railroad got its name -- Long history of slave escapes, and of fugitive slave laws -- Tracks and stations -- Stationmasters -- Conductors -- Harriet Tubman, the woman called Moses -- Railroad songs -- Train robbers -- Passengers -- John Brown, fugitive slave -- Publicists -- End of the line -- Time line -- Bibliography -- Index.
